    Pollination and Flowering

    When grapefruit trees reach maturity, around 5-6 years of age, they start producing flowers. These flowers play a crucial role in the reproduction process. The pollen from the male parts of the flower needs to reach the female parts for fertilization to occur. This transfer of pollen can happen through natural agents like wind, insects, or even human intervention in cultivation.

    Fruit Development

    Once pollination is successful, the fertilized flower develops into a fruit over time. The grapefruit tree nurtures the growing fruit as it matures, providing essential nutrients and support for its development. The fruit continues to grow until it reaches its optimal size and ripens, ready for harvest.

    Seed Dispersal

    Within the ripe grapefruit are the seeds, essential for the tree’s reproduction cycle. As the fruit falls to the ground or is harvested, the seeds have the potential to germinate and grow into new grapefruit trees. Natural processes, wildlife, or human intervention can aid in seed dispersal, ensuring the cycle continues.

    Environmental Factors

    Environmental conditions play a significant role in grapefruit tree reproduction. Factors like sunlight, water, soil quality, and temperature impact the tree’s growth, flowering, and fruiting. Maintaining ideal conditions through proper care and cultivation practices can enhance the tree’s reproductive success.

    Asexual Reproduction Methods in Grapefruit Trees

    When it comes to grapefruit trees, asexual reproduction methods play a crucial role in their propagation. Let’s delve into the key ways these trees reproduce without the need for pollination.

    Grafting

    Grafting is a common asexual propagation method used in grapefruit tree cultivation. In this process, a part of one grapefruit tree, known as the scion, is attached to the rootstock of another tree. The scion retains the genetic characteristics of the parent tree, allowing for the production of fruit consistent with the desired qualities.

    Budding

    Another asexual reproduction technique is budding. This method involves attaching a bud from a grapefruit tree onto a rootstock. Over time, the bud develops into a new shoot that eventually grows into a fully-fledged grapefruit tree. Budding allows for the propagation of grapefruit trees with specific traits, ensuring desirable fruit characteristics.

    Cutting Propagation

    Cutting propagation is a simple yet effective asexual reproduction method for grapefruit trees. By taking cuttings from a mature tree and encouraging them to root in a suitable growing medium, new grapefruit trees can be grown. This technique enables growers to produce multiple grapefruit trees from a single parent plant, maintaining the genetic lineage of the original tree.

    Layering

    Layering is another technique commonly used for asexual reproduction in grapefruit trees. In this method, a branch of the grapefruit tree is bent and partially buried in the soil. Over time, roots develop at the buried section, allowing for the branch to be severed and transplanted as a new tree. Layering can be a reliable way to propagate grapefruit trees with minimal equipment and resources.

    1. Environmental Conditions

    Environmental factors greatly affect the reproductive success of grapefruit trees. Factors such as temperature, humidity, and sunlight can influence the flowering process, pollination, and fruit development. Adequate sunlight exposure is crucial for optimal flower production, while temperature variations can affect the timing of flowering and fruit set.

    2. Soil Quality

    The quality of the soil in which grapefruit trees are planted can significantly impact their reproductive capabilities. Well-draining soil rich in nutrients supports healthy root development, which is essential for overall tree growth and reproductive success. Proper soil pH levels are also critical for optimal nutrient uptake and flower production.

    3. Pollination

    Pollination plays a vital role in grapefruit tree reproduction. Cross-pollination between compatible varieties can enhance fruit set and yield. Factors such as the presence of pollinators like bees and other beneficial insects can greatly influence the pollination process. Ensuring a diverse and active pollinator population can improve fruit quality and quantity.

    4. Pruning Practices

    Pruning is an essential cultural practice that can impact the reproductive capacity of grapefruit trees. Proper pruning techniques help maintain tree structure, promote air circulation, and facilitate sunlight penetration into the canopy. Pruning also removes dead or diseased branches, promoting new growth and enhancing fruit production.

    5. Pest and Disease Management

    Effective pest and disease management are crucial for ensuring the reproductive health of grapefruit trees. Pests such as citrus psyllids and diseases like citrus greening can negatively impact flower production, fruit development, and overall tree vigor. Implementing integrated pest management strategies can help mitigate these risks and promote healthy reproduction.

    6. Watering and Fertilization

    Proper watering and fertilization practices are vital for supporting the reproductive needs of grapefruit trees. Maintaining adequate soil moisture levels during flowering and fruit development stages is essential for optimal growth and fruit set. Balanced fertilization with essential nutrients such as nitrogen, phosphorus, and potassium can contribute to increased flower production and fruit quality.
